A method of constructing an elevator core structure for a space elevator tower. The actively stabilized space elevator tower is a pneumatically pressurized structure formed from flexible sheet material. This construction method comprises raising a core segment with a climbing construction elevator that grips the outer surface of the core structure, sliding the core segment on top of the core structure on a horizontal track, and actively adjusting the core structure's center of mass. The freestanding tower can be used for launch activities, tourism, observation, energy generation, scientific research, and communications.
